fix: bootstrap SSL/CA for research CLI on corporate MacBooks
Extract app/ssl_bootstrap.py (shared with FastAPI main), wire it into research scripts, and teach run_tier1_macbook.sh to locate combined-ca-bundle.pem, certifi, optional USE_CORP_PROXY, plus --ssl-check diagnostics.

"""TLS / corporate-proxy bootstrap for CLI scripts and the API.
|
||||
|
||||
Must run **before** httpx / alpaca / aiohttp open connections.
|
||||
|
||||
Resolution order for the CA bundle:
|
||||
1. ``combined-ca-bundle.pem`` in the repo root (gitignored corporate bundle)
|
||||
2. ``$HOME/combined-ca-bundle.pem`` (MacBook path used by existing tooling)
|
||||
3. ``SSL_CERT_FILE`` / ``REQUESTS_CA_BUNDLE`` if already set and present
|
||||
4. ``certifi.where()`` when the package is installed
|
||||
5. System defaults (no patch)
|
||||
|
||||
Optional corporate proxy (Swisscom-style) when ``USE_CORP_PROXY=1``.
|
||||
"""
